Output 21ed60c226518620556b20908b8e24ee2aafce7f68b9f9c9a4bb481eca90e60b:0

value
1679111
script pubkey
OP_0 OP_PUSHBYTES_20 0dda29d6047a7691b544aca5931ca733963918ba
address
bc1qphdzn4sy0fmfrd2y4jjex898xwtrjx96rv7nkx
transaction
21ed60c226518620556b20908b8e24ee2aafce7f68b9f9c9a4bb481eca90e60b
spent
true